Lewis County amends homeless-services contracts, adds about $1.09 million

Lewis County Board of Commissioners · April 29, 2026
AI-Generated Content: All content on this page was generated by AI to highlight key points from the meeting. For complete details and context, we recommend watching the full video. so we can fix them.

Summary

The Board approved amendments to consolidated homeless-grant contracts that add $160,000 to Hope Alliance (total $405,122) and $929,000 to Coastal Community Action Program (total maximum $1,798,323.60) to fund shelter, rapid rehousing and related services through mid-2027.

Lewis County commissioners on April 28 approved amendments to two consolidated homeless-grant contracts that together add about $1.09 million for housing and essential needs services.
